Bengaluru’s office space stock to become highest in India by 2030
The report also pointed out that with an average annual absorption of about 15-16 million sq. ft. over the past few years, Bengaluru has also been the front-runner in office absorption as compared with other Indian cities. Technology, engineering & manufacturing and BFSI sectors are expected to be the main demand drivers of office space while life sciences, aviation and automobile are likely to be the emerging sectors that would drive demand.
